LUBRICATION
The reducer is normally equipped without having lubricant.The advised amount of lubricant is indicated on our catalogue and the very first changed have to be completed right after fifty-60 hours of operating,then replaced after 600-800 operating hours. The emptying of the gearbox should be made quickly right after the operating,with the oil even now sizzling,in order to keep away from the deposition of sludge.Check frequently the oil degree and best up the oil each time required.

Indicators of Driveshaft Failure

Determining a defective driveshaft is easy if you’ve ever listened to a odd sounds from beneath your car. These sounds are triggered by worn U-joints and bearings supporting the push shaft. When they fall short, the generate shafts quit rotating properly, making a clanking or squeaking seem. When this transpires, you may possibly listen to noise from the side of the steering wheel or ground.
In addition to noise, a defective driveshaft can lead to your vehicle to swerve in restricted corners. It can also lead to suspended bindings that restrict total manage. Generate shaft kind

Driveshafts are used in many diverse varieties of cars. These include four-wheel drive, entrance-motor rear-wheel push, motorcycles and boats. Each and every variety of generate shaft has its personal goal. Below is an overview of the 3 most frequent types of drive shafts:
The driveshaft is a round, elongated shaft that transmits torque from the motor to the wheels. Generate shafts usually incorporate numerous joints to compensate for modifications in size or angle. Some drive shafts also contain connecting shafts and inner consistent velocity joints. Some also contain torsional dampers, spline joints, and even prismatic joints. The most crucial factor about the driveshaft is that it plays a essential role in transmitting torque from the motor to the wheels.
The push shaft requirements to be the two light and powerful to shift torque. Even though metal is the most commonly employed substance for automotive driveshafts, other materials this sort of as aluminum, composites, and carbon fiber are also typically employed. Cardan joints are yet another frequent push shaft. A common joint, also acknowledged as a U-joint, is a adaptable coupling that enables one shaft to generate the other at an angle. This type of push shaft makes it possible for electrical power to be transmitted while the angle of the other shaft is consistently modifying.
